Zhaga Certification

Zhaga is an international consortium of companies from the lighting industry that develops interface specifications for components used in LED luminaires. These specifications define how elements such as light engines, drivers, sensors, and communication modules connect and interact within a luminaire.
Zhaga certification confirms that components and luminaires comply with these interface specifications, enabling interoperable lighting systems and supporting reliable integration of compatible components from different manufacturers.

Why Zhaga Matters​

Zhaga specifications introduce standardised interfaces that support modular luminaire architectures and simplify the integration of lighting components.
For manufacturers, system integrators and lighting operators, this approach offers several advantages:
  • Improved compatibility between components from different suppliers.
  • Simplified luminaire design and component integration.​
  • Easier maintenance and replacement of lighting components.​
  • Increased flexibility for smart and connected lighting infrastructures.
By supporting interoperable, upgradeable lighting systems, Zhaga contributes to long-term compatibility and innovation in modern lighting ecosystems.

Components and luminaires covered by Zhaga Certification

Zhaga certification confirms that specific components used in LED luminaires comply with defined interface specifications, enabling reliable integration in compatible lighting systems.​
DEKRA supports certification for multiple Zhaga specifications, including key Zhaga Books covering luminaires, LED light engines, LED modules and smart connectivity interfaces, such as Book 18 and Book 20 used in Zhaga-D4i lighting systems.
Zhaga certification may apply to:
  • Luminaires.
  • LED light engines and interchangeable light sources.
  • Sensors and communication nodes.
  • LED drivers and electronic control gear.
  • Standardised LED modules used within LED luminaires.
The Zhaga mark identifies luminaires and LED luminaire components that comply with the relevant specifications, helping manufacturers and integrators recognise compatible products.

Zhaga-D4i and Connected Lighting​

Zhaga-D4i combines Zhaga specifications that define luminaire interfaces with D4i communication standards, enabling interoperable, connected lighting systems.
This approach enables:
  • Integration of sensors and communication nodes.
  • Plug-and-play IoT-ready luminaires.
  • Standardized interfaces for smart lighting infrastructures.
  • Flexible system upgrades and maintenance.

Zhaga and Sustainable LED Lighting​
Zhaga-based luminaire architectures support component replaceability and system upgrades, extending product lifetime and reducing material waste. This modular approach aligns with the growing sustainability requirements and circular economy objectives in the lighting industry.​ By enabling serviceable, upgradeable lighting systems, Zhaga contributes to more resource-efficient lighting infrastructure.
